Visualizzazione dei risultati da 1 a 5 su 5
  1. #1
    Utente di HTML.it
    Registrato dal
    Jul 2009
    Messaggi
    40

    visualizzare data in database con asp

    ho un db con tre campi nome-matricola- data i primi due sono testo la data è(data/ora)
    se cerco di estrarre tramite asp una data precisa mi rende err(tipo dati non corrispondenti espressione criterio)


    posto un pò di codice

    dim abi,obi
    abi="12"
    obi= CDate(Month(12)&"/"& Day(22)&"/"& Year(2010)
    dim strxxx
    strxxx = "SELECT tabella.cognome FROM tabella WHERE ndim='"&abi&"' AND data= '"&obi&"'"
    set rsA = dbConn.Execute(strxxx)
    do while not rsA.EOF
    %>
    <td bgcolor="#ffff88"><Font size="3" color="blue"> <%Response.Write rsA("cognome")%></font></td>

    <%
    rsA.moveNext
    loop
    rsA.Close
    Set rsA = Nothing


    funziona solo se il campo data lo converto in testo ma non è quello che voglio

    dove sbaglio

  2. #2
    usa # invece di '
    .. AND data= #"&obi&"#...

  3. #3
    Utente di HTML.it
    Registrato dal
    Jul 2009
    Messaggi
    40
    l'èrrore è scomparso ma i dati non vengono restituiti

  4. #4
    mi ero concentrato sulla query e nn ho guardato il resto ma
    questo
    obi= CDate(Month(12)&"/"& Day(22)&"/"& Year(2010)

    non significa niente
    fai semplicemente

    obi="12/22/2010"

  5. #5
    Utente di HTML.it
    Registrato dal
    Jul 2009
    Messaggi
    40
    scusa se rispondo solo ora ma ho dei problemi con adsl
    funziona perfettamente grazie

Permessi di invio

  • Non puoi inserire discussioni
  • Non puoi inserire repliche
  • Non puoi inserire allegati
  • Non puoi modificare i tuoi messaggi
  •  
Powered by vBulletin® Version 4.2.1
Copyright © 2025 vBulletin Solutions, Inc. All rights reserved.